Output c8d266594e644fc149ca8e15643dabf8f29cfb41bdabcc6ffae30f57a05740cb:1

value
20436749
script pubkey
OP_0 OP_PUSHBYTES_20 ccb9c016eb293658f78cae4758021d3a72c5420b
address
bc1qejuuq9ht9ym93auv4er4sqsa8fev2sstem9a96
transaction
c8d266594e644fc149ca8e15643dabf8f29cfb41bdabcc6ffae30f57a05740cb
confirmations
103351
spent
true